Hey, have you ever stopped to think if it's really possible to make extra money playing on your phone? Yeah, I’ve been testing some paid gaming apps, and the truth is, it does work, but it’s not that easy money that people promise. It’s enough to supplement your income, nothing more.



I looked for apps that pay for real and found that most work like this: you complete simple tasks, play mini-games, download other apps, or answer surveys. Then, you accumulate credits that you can withdraw via PayPal or directly to Pix. It’s not rocket science, but it does require patience.

The ones I tested and recommend: Cash App is the most practical because it pays directly via Pix, no need to go through PayPal. Then there’s CashPirate, which is quite popular here in Brazil and works well. Make Money is straightforward for beginners, but it takes time to accumulate cash. If you really enjoy mini-games, Gamee and Big Time have raffles that yield more, but it’s all luck. Toloka is different because you do real tasks, it’s not a game, but it pays better than the others.

The trick is not to expect to get rich from this. Choose a paid gaming app that suits you, be consistent, and you’re set. For example, I earned about R$150 last month without spending anything, just playing during work breaks. Nothing crazy, but it helps.

Oh, and watch out for fake apps that promise astronomical earnings. There are many scams out there. Keep an eye on real reviews, see if people are actually getting paid.
